====== Adding some chicken ====== {{:poussin.png?100}} After installing the nest (aka the distribution skeleton, see [[en:dwl:nest:start|Preparing the nest]]), you can add chicken (aka applications). Note that an hen will help you managing your chicken (see [[:en:dwl:hen|Adding a hen in the nest]]). If you are lost, please see the [[en:dwl:howto|How to proceed]] page. We sort here the applications by families; an application can belong to several families. Note: currently, all the applications are not available on our new wiki; they should be available soon. ===== Alphabetical order ===== * [[en:dwl:chicken-alt:start|ALT]] [[en:dwl:chicken-and:start|AND]] * [[en:dwl:chicken-bas:start|BAS]] [[en:dwl:chicken-bth:start|BTH]] * [[en:dwl:chicken-can:start|CAN]] [[en:dwl:chicken-cht:start|CHT]] [[en:dwl:chicken-cgw:start|CGW]] [[en:dwl:chicken-cip:start|CIP]] [[en:dwl:chicken-cnm:start|CNM]] [[en:dwl:chicken-cnv:start|CNV]] [[en:dwl:chicken-col:start|COL]] [[en:dwl:chicken-ctm:start|CTM]] * [[en:dwl:chicken-dds:start|DDS]] [[en:dwl:chicken-dff:start|DFF]] [[en:dwl:chicken-dif:start|DIF]] [[en:dwl:chicken-dwl:start|DWL]] * [[en:dwl:chicken-fad:start|FAD]] [[en:dwl:chicken-fus:start|FUS]] [[en:dwl:chicken-frg:start|FRG]] * [[en:dwl:chicken-geo:start|GEO]] [[en:dwl:chicken-gps:start|GPS]] [[en:dwl:chicken-grp:start|GRP]] [[en:dwl:chicken-gtw:start|GTW]] * [[en:dwl:chicken-hlg:start|HLG]] [[en:dwl:chicken-hop:start|HOP]] * [[en:dwl:chicken-ial:start|IAL]] [[en:dwl:chicken-inf:start|INF]] [[en:dwl:chicken-inu:start|INU]] * [[en:dwl:chicken-launchtk:start|launchtk]] * [[en:dwl:chicken-lrd:start|LRD]] * [[en:dwl:chicken-lrmt:start|LRMT]] * [[en:dwl:chicken-map:start|MAP]] [[en:dwl:chicken-met:start|MET]] * [[en:dwl:chicken-ncm:start|NCM]] [[en:dwl:chicken-net:start|NET]] [[en:dwl:chicken-ntk:start|NTK]] * [[en:dwl:chicken-obu:start|OBU]] * [[en:dwl:chicken-pac:start|PAC]] [[en:dwl:chicken-pgt:start|PGT]] [[en:dwl:chicken-pol:start|POL]] [[en:dwl:chicken-pth:start|PTH]] * [[en:dwl:chicken-rsu:start|RSU]] * [[en:dwl:chicken-sed:start|SED]] [[en:dwl:chicken-sec:start|SEC]] [[en:dwl:chicken-ser:start|SER]] [[en:dwl:chicken-skt:start|SKT]] [[en:dwl:chicken-spg:start|SPG]] [[en:dwl:chicken-sto:start|STO]] [[en:dwl:chicken-syb:start|SYB]] * [[en:dwl:chicken-tab:start|TAB]] [[en:dwl:chicken-tof:start|TOF]] [[en:dwl:chicken-tst:start|TST]] [[en:dwl:chicken-tel:start|TEL]] [[en:dwl:chicken-tlk:start|TLK]] * [[en:dwl:chicken-uni:start|UNI]] [[en:dwl:chicken-uav:start|UAV]] * [[en:dwl:chicken-vic:start|VIC]] [[en:dwl:chicken-vid:start|VID]] [[en:dwl:chicken-vox:start|VOX]] [[en:dwl:chicken-vsn:start|VSN]] * [[en:dwl:chicken-wtr:start|WTR]] [[en:dwl:chicken-wav:start|WAV]] [[en:dwl:chicken-wfw:start|WFW]] [[en:dwl:chicken-wha:start|WHA]] [[en:dwl:chicken-who:start|WHO]] [[en:dwl:chicken-whe:start|WHE]] * [[en:dwl:chicken-xbe:start|XBE]] ===== Applications for teaching ===== * [[en:dwl:chicken-bas:start|BAS]] a __bas__ic application that generates messages * [[en:dwl:chicken-net:start|NET]] a __net__working application for controlling the distributed execution of BAS ===== Applications used by other applications ===== * [[en:dwl:chicken-cnv:start|CNV]] a __c__o__nv__oi detection application * [[en:dwl:chicken-inf:start|INF]] a UDP proxy and a php web page on the __inf__rastructure * [[en:dwl:chicken-gps:start|GPS]] a __gps__ service (and more!) application * [[en:dwl:chicken-grp:start|GRP]] a __gr__ou__p__ service application * [[en:dwl:chicken-gtw:start|GTW]] a __g__a__t__e__w__ay application for accessing Internet * [[en:dwl:chicken-map:start|MAP]] a __map__ drawing application (and more!) * [[en:dwl:chicken-pth:start|PTH]] an application for unicast communication, that maintains a __p__a__th__ in a dynamic networks * [[en:dwl:chicken-sec:start|SEC]] an applicationn for __sec__uring data exchange * [[en:dwl:chicken-sto:start|STO]] an applicationn for __sto__ring data * [[en:dwl:chicken-vsn:start|VSN]] a neighbor discovering application ("__v__oi__s__i__n__age" in french) * [[en:dwl:chicken-vic:start|VIC]] a __vic__inity discovery application ===== Applications used by humans ===== * [[en:dwl:chicken-alt:start|ALT]] an __al__er__t__ application * [[en:dwl:chicken-bth:start|BTH]] an application for __B__lue__t__oo__t__h connexion * [[en:dwl:chicken-cht:start|CHT]] an application for __ch__a__t__ing * [[en:dwl:chicken-chv:start|CHV]] an application for __v__ocal __ch__ating * [[en:dwl:chicken-cnv:start|CNV]] a __c__o__nv__oi detection application * [[en:dwl:chicken-lrd:start|LRD]] a dynamic best path computation application * [[en:dwl:chicken-map:start|MAP]] a __map__ drawing application (and more!) * [[en:dwl:chicken-pac:start|PAC]] a __Pac__pus interface program * [[en:dwl:chicken-tab:start|TAB]] an application for collaborative drawing ("__tab__leau blanc" in french) * [[en:dwl:chicken-tlk:start|TLK]] a __t__a__lk__ application * [[en:dwl:chicken-tab:start|TOF]] an application for opportunistic file downloading ("__t__éléchargement __o__pportuniste de __f__ichiers" in french) * [[en:dwl:chicken-vic:start|VIC]] a __vic__inity discovery application * [[en:dwl:chicken-vid:start|VID]] an application for __vid__eo transfert * [[en:dwl:chicken-wtr:start|WTR]] a __w__ea__t__he__r__ forcast application ===== Applications for multihop communication ===== * [[en:dwl:chicken-dds:start|DDS]] an application for optimized __d__iffusion (broadcast) using __d__i__s__tance ("__d__iffusion avec la __d__i__s__tance" in french) * [[en:dwl:chicken-dff:start|DFF]] an application for reliable broadcast (__d__i__f__fusion __f__iable" in french) * [[en:dwl:chicken-dif:start|DIF]] an application for simple __dif__fusion (broadcast) * [[en:dwl:chicken-hop:start|HOP]] an implementation of the conditional transmissions (our routing strategy for dynamic networks) * [[en:dwl:chicken-pth:start|PTH]] an application for unicast communication, that maintains a __p__a__th__ in a dynamic networks in dynamic networks ===== Applications for neighborhood management ===== * [[en:dwl:chicken-bth:start|BTH]] an application for __B__lue__t__oo__t__h connexion * [[en:dwl:chicken-cnv:start|CNV]] a __c__o__nv__oi detection application * [[en:dwl:chicken-gtw:start|GTW]] a __g__a__t__e__w__ay application for accessing Internet * [[en:dwl:chicken-ial:start|IAL]] an __I__s __AL__ive application for announcing presence to neighbors and computing RTT * [[en:dwl:chicken-vic:start|VIC]] a __vic__inity discovery application * [[en:dwl:chicken-vsn:start|VSN]] a neighbor discovering application ("__v__oi__s__i__n__age" in french) ===== Applications for distributed services ===== * GRP * COL * SER * SYB * UNI * WAV * WFM ===== Technical applications ===== * [[en:dwl:chicken-bth:start|BTH]] an application for __B__lue__t__oo__t__h connexion * [[en:dwl:chicken-cgw:start|CGW]] a __c__ar __g__ate__w__ay between Pacpus and Airplug * [[en:dwl:chicken-io:start|IO]] a basic application for testing messages (__i__nput and __o__utput) * [[en:dwl:chicken-launchtk:start|launchtk]] a template application for mixing C and Tcl/Tk languages * [[en:dwl:chicken-ntk:start|NTK]] a template application for the ''--notk'' option (designing applications able to run either with or without Tk) * [[en:dwl:chicken-skt:start|SKT]] an application for connecting non-airplug applications through __s__oc__k__e__t__ * [[en:dwl:chicken-tst:start|TST]] an application for performance evaluation on the road (__t__e__st__ing) * [[en:dwl:chicken-wha:start|WHA]] a template application for __wha__t message format * [[en:dwl:chicken-who:start|WHO]] a template application for __who__ message format * [[en:dwl:chicken-whe:start|WHE]] a template application for __whe__re message format ([[http://www.flickr.com/photos/21806934@N03/4799230992/|original image here]])